Bob has 2 times as many dimes as nickels and the value of the dimes is 4.65 more than the value of the nickels. How many dimes and nickels does he have.

1 nickle = 5 cents
1 dime = 10 cents
let
n = the number of nickles that Bob has
d = the number of dimes that Bob has
Bob has 2 times as many dimes as nickels
d = 2n
the value of the dimes is $4.65 more than the value of the nickels
10d = 465 + 5*n
by solving the system of equations
d = 2n
10d = 465 + 5*n
we find
d = 62 dimes
n = 31 nickles
